ShowBiz Pizza Place, often shortened to ShowBiz Pizza or ShowBiz, was an American family entertainment center and restaurant pizza chain founded in 1980 by Robert L. Brock and Creative Engineering (CEI). It emerged after a separation between Brock and owners of the Chuck E. Cheese franchise, Pizza Time Theatre.

Freddy Trap · 812K views ; First And Last Showbiz Pizza Place Locations Opened In Each State.The first Chuck E. Cheese's Pizza Time Theatre opened on May 17, 1977 in San Jose, California. The pilot location was a 5,000 square foot former brokerage building and was the first restaurant of its kind – offering a combination of pizza, animated entertainment, and an indoor arcade.

Panama City, FL (4432 US-98) was a Showbiz Pizza Place/Chuck E. Cheese that opened on May 7, 1986, and closed in Spring 2007. Stages. When this store first opened, it featured a Rock-afire Explosion stage, as all Showbiz locations did. The stage would undergo Concept Unification in June 1991. Exterior (January, 2023) Antioch, TN (5312 Hickory Hollow Lane) was a Showbiz Pizza Place that opened on May 3, 1983 with a Rock-Afire Explosion, which is still open to this day. This converted to a Chuck E. Cheese around 1991, and converted to a Studio C Beta and then received 2.0 in December 2021.To make this happen, ShowBiz hired Creative Presentations Inc. Exterior, 2017. 5151 Lakewood Blvd, Store #357 is a Showbiz Pizza Place that opened on March 23, 1983 with a Rock-Afire Explosion, which is still open to this day. This location is located in the Lakewood Shopping Center right next to the Lakewood Center Mall. They would receive Concept Unification in 1991 or 1992, and ...

[1] The vast majority of former ShowBiz Pizza Place locations were converted into Chuck E. Cheese's locations. These locations used the 3-Stage show format. Some locations were also closed at this time, while other former ShowBiz locations converted to independent entities.

Due to complications involving the Rock-afire Explosion still under development ...Concept Unification was the process at ShowBiz Pizza Place whereby Rock-afire Explosion stages were converted to the 3-Stage Munch's Make Believe Band format during the early 1990s. In addition, ShowBiz Pizza Place locations would be converted to Chuck E. Cheese's, while still retaining the "Where a Kid Can Be a Kid" jingle and slogan.The first ShowBiz Pizza Place opened in Kansas City, Missouri, on March 3, 1980. The rebranding allowed BBWL to avoid the upcoming and possibly imminent Concept …Over the course of the history of CEC Entertainment and predecessor companies, a number of stages have been constructed and operated in restaurants. Stages operated in restaurants typically include one or more animatronic characters. Earlier stages usually contained five or more animatronic characters on stage, while most newer stages feature only one character on stage. Winchester PTT Show ...

"Birthday Extravaganza" was a song commonly sung by the "Pizza Time Players" during birthday events at "Pizza Time Theatre" locations. The song can be considered a precursor to the "Birthday Star" shows commonly seen at Chuck E. Cheese's locations today. The song was, ironically, sung by Rolfe and Earl, during "The Rolfe ...
